What can I see and do near Harajiri Falls?
Oka Castle Ruins, Fukoji Temple and Deai Bridge are landmarks that you won't want to miss. You might spend a leisurely day outdoors at Nakashima Park and Fumio Asakura Memorial Museum. Taizako Canyon, Kawada Spring Water and Chinda Falls are beautiful places to appreciate nature.
